Popular Dance Styles

Lakeland studios cover Waltz, Tango, Foxtrot, Cha-Cha, Rumba, Salsa, and Swing, plus wedding dance preparation for couples planning a first dance. Whether you want a structured curriculum or a casual social night, there's an option nearby.

What to Expect as a Beginner

You don't need a partner or dance background to get started. Most classes welcome singles and rotate partners so every student practices lead and follow roles.

FAQ

How much do ballroom dance classes in Lakeland cost?

Group classes typically cost $20 to $40 per session, and private lessons run about $80 to $150 per hour.

Do I need a partner for lessons near the RP Funding Center in Lakeland, FL?

No, studios in the area regularly welcome solo students into group classes.
